<p>Having spent over twelve years as a teacher of preschoolers and toddlers…in addition to having raised my own child…… <img src='http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> …….I know only too well the joys&#8230;and challenges&#8230; that preschoolers can present on a day to day basis. Introduce them to something as overwhelming as Walt Disney World, and those challenges&#8230;and joys&#8230;.become magnified. Being prepared is even more important with these little ones, if you want a magical vacation.</p>
<p>Knowing this, I was honored to be able to review the 2011 edition of <strong><em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1453640398?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=9325&amp;creativeASIN=1453640398">Beyond the Attractions: A Guide to Walt Disney World with Preschoolers</a></em></strong><em>. </em>While there are a number of great Disney World guidebooks on the market, most are “general” types of books, providing valuable information, but not necessarily the kind of things that a mom (or dad) specifically needs to know when traveling to Disney with little ones. Such as which attractions your preschooler will probably love…and which ones could very likely scare the dickens out of them.  Or how the Baby Care Centers can be a lifesaver. Or what to do to make sure you don’t get lost from your preschooler at the parks (at Disney, children don’t get lost, their parents do…) Or what kinds of things you need to pack specifically for preschoolers.  <strong><em>Beyond the Attractions</em></strong> provides this information and a great deal more, making it indispensable in my opinion, for anyone who will be visiting Disney World with preschoolers or toddlers. Even Disney veterans who may have been many times before, will benefit from Lisa’s practical “mom” perspective, especially if this is a first trip with young children. As Lisa says in the introduction of the book, she offers a “new approach”:</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em>“This Walt Disney World guidebook differs from other Disney World guidebooks in that it is not a general overview of everything the parks have to offer – much of which may not apply to small children – but is devoted solely to visiting with preschoolers. With a Disney World travel guide that provides specialized information and tips relevant to small kids, you’ll be able to plan an incredible trip with your preschoolers without wading through hundreds of pages of general information. Save hours of research with a succinct, yet complete Disney World travel guide that is easy to read without a lot of filler. </em></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em> </em></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><strong><em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1453640398?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=9325&amp;creativeASIN=1453640398">Beyond the Attractions: A Guide to Walt Disney World with Preschoolers</a></em></strong><em> was written by a parent for parents and caregivers. As a mother who has vacationed at Disney World with a young family, I know what parents care about and need to know when planning a Walt Disney World trip</em>.”</p>
<p><em> </em></p>
<p>One of the things that I especially like about <strong><em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1453640398?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=9325&amp;creativeASIN=1453640398">Beyond the Attractions</a></em></strong> is that at 173 pages, it is an easy read: it’s filled with tons of valuable information, but yet not so long that you feel like you are reading War and Peace. Starting with “Top Six Tips for Travel with Preschoolers”, Lisa then moves on to discuss specific things that need to be considered when planning a Disney vacation as they relate to preschoolers. So for example, in “Preparing” she shares her thoughts on determining if your child is ready for a Disney vacation, gives some excellent planning advice, and provides helpful ideas for handling the “anticipation” factor with little ones. She then covers some of the basics like Lodging, Transportation, Touring, Attractions, Activities, Recreation, and Dining in subsequent chapters, all with planning tips for making things as stress-free for little ones…and their grown-ups….as possible.</p>
<p>Some of the most valuable information to the parents of preschoolers comes in the later chapters:</p>
<ul>
<li>Child Care and Safety: Here      there is important information about safety, child-proofing, child      identification, first aid as well as child care services so mom and dad      can have some time for themselves if they want. <img src='http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</li>
<li>Must-Do List: The best      activities for Toddlers and Preschoolers</li>
<li>Resources: This section is indispensable      with a list of important phone numbers, websites, books, local shopping,      medical care and pharmacies (because unfortunately those ear infections      still happen while you’re on vacation)</li>
<li>Planning and Packing      Checklists: Think you know everything you should bring to Disney with your      preschoolers? Lisa has a complete list with ideas for things that are “must-brings”      on a Disney vacation no matter what the age of your family members (I will      be adding several to our next Disney trip).</li>
<li>Paying for the Magic: Always      near and dear to The Affordable Mouse, there are some very helpful ideas      for saving for your trip…and on your trip.</li>
</ul>
<p>Traveling to Disney with little ones has its own challenges that <strong><em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1453640398?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=9325&amp;creativeASIN=1453640398">Beyond the Attractions: A Guide to Walt Disney World with Preschoolers</a> </em></strong>will definitely prepare you for. I mentioned earlier in this review that Lisa starts her book with her Top Six Tips for Travel with Preschoolers. My years of working with preschoolers make this one my favorite:</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;"><em>“<strong>Don’t Force the Issue</strong>.</em><em> Preschoolers are a funny bunch. They sometimes have difficulty communicating a fear or just plain discomfort with a ride or situation. If they resist a particular attraction, don’t force the issue; it’s easier to find a ride they do enjoy than having to coax them on future rides if they have a “bad” experience.“</em></p>

<p><strong><a href="%22http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1587710730?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=9325&amp;creativeASIN=1587710730">PassPorter Walt Disney World </a></strong>is very possibly one of my favorite Disney vacation  planners, probably because organization is <a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1587710730?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=1587710730"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-194" title="passporter" src="http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/passporter2.jpg" alt="passporter" width="116" height="160" /></a>my thing. <img src='http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' />  Filled with lots of detailed information about every aspect of Walt Disney World,  in cluding the parks, the resorts, and the restaurants, it is organized so well  that it is very easy to follow….and very easy to quickly find just what you are  looking for.</p>
<p>The authors cover each of the 4 parks in great detail, including full-color fold-out maps, tons of their personal pictures, and a complete description of every ride and attraction (this is so helpful!). There are also profiles of each of the Disney-owned hotels which also include maps, color photos, and room layouts. And then there are the reviews of each of the Disney World dining options&#8230;.all 300+ of them. What is especially nice are the average meal costs for each, from counter-service to table-service. This is a great help when trying to decide where you want to eat before you get to Disney!</p>
<p>All of this is great and makes the <a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/1587710730?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=1587710730"><strong>Passporter Walt Disney World</strong> </a>a valuable resource in itself. But the aspect that I like the best are the handy organizer pockets and journal. This is the perfect place to keep your maps, passes, receipts, must-see lists, as well as anything else that you need to keep! And with a place to make notes and journal memories of your trip, you end up with a wonderful keepsake at the end of your trip!</p>

<p>At over 800 pages, the<strong> <a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/0470460261?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=0470460261">Unofficial Guide to Walt Disney World 2010</a></strong> is the book for<a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/0470460261?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=0470460261"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-182" title="51cYJbqBF6L._SL160_" src="http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/51cYJbqBF6L._SL160_1.jpg" alt="51cYJbqBF6L._SL160_" width="102" height="160" /></a> the Disney World visitor who want to know everything there is to know about the parks. It is thorough and provides an unbiased perspective of all the Disney parks, plus SeaWorld and Universal.</p>
<p>To say that it is detailed would be an understatement. Yet it is this detail that make this the book of choice for many. This guide covers pretty much every aspect of a vacation to the Orlando area that you could possibly think of. And it does it without bias, and is, in fact, not shy about being critical where needed.</p>
<p>I will be honest here though, and say that when I read the <a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/0470460261?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=0470460261"><strong>Unofficial Guide to Walt Disney World 2010</strong></a>, while I appreciated the author&#8217;s forthrightness, as a Disney-lover, I was not always a big fan of the cynicism. After all, I am going to Disney for the &#8220;magic&#8221;&#8230;don&#8217;t spoil it for me, ok? <img src='http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_wink.gif' alt=';)' class='wp-smiley' /> </p>
<p>All kidding aside though, I will also be honest and say that many folks really want a critical perspective to help in their Disney vacation planning&#8230;and if you are one of them, then you will like this book.</p>
<p>Other than that, there is much to appreciate in the Unofficial Guide. One of the most popular aspects of this book are the Touring Plans which offer how-to guides for spending a day or so at each park. Very helpful indeed, especially if you are planning a trip during one of the busiest times of the year.</p>
<p>While all of the detailed information is great, it is alot of information in my opinion, and is definitely not a little book to take to the parks with you. Still, if you want a great planning guide and don’t mind wading through the many chapters, the <strong><a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/0470460261?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=0470460261">Unofficial Guide to Walt Disney World 2010</a> </strong>may be, for you, the very <a href="http://theaffordablemouse.com/disney-guidebooks/"><strong>best way to see Disney World</strong></a>.</p>

<p>As a matter of fact, there are a lot of things I like about this book. To start, the color pictures are extremely helpful in giving lots of detail about the parks, rides, and attractions: this can be a great tool to help prepare for what to expect&#8230;especially for little ones.</p>
<p>I also really like the size, as it is small enough to be easily transported with you to the parks, which is a great benefit. Some books have a wealth of information, but are the size of a phonebook&#8230;.which is just not helpful when you want to find something quickly. And let&#8217;s face it, if you are new to Disney World, the chances are very good that you are going to have questions&#8230;and isn&#8217;t it nice to be able to refer to a well-organized guidebook to find your answers <em>while in the park</em>? Not only is the <a href="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/0970959672?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=theaffomous-20&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1789&amp;creative=390957&amp;creativeASIN=0970959672"><strong>Complete Walt Disney World 2010</strong></a> small enough to be able to do this easily, with each park color-coded, you can find what you want almost immediately. I really like that! <img src='http://theaffordablemouse.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</p>
<p>There are also some great tips and ratings on the rides and attractions, which is very helpful for doing your planning. Of special note are the suggested touring plans as well as descriptions, wait times, and a kid’s “Fear Factor”  for each ride. Any parent traveling with children to Walt Disney World for the first time should be prepared for the Fear Factor on each ride: nothing ruins the magic more than a terrified child.</p>
